Care Instructions
Vacuum regularly and thoroughly:
- Vacuum the rug on both sides and the floor underneath regularly. Never use the brush attachment when vacuuming and adjust the suction strength. Avoid vacuuming the rug's edges or fringes as they may get damaged. Rugs with pile should be vacuumed in the direction of the pile.
Rug underlay:
- The rug has an unlined backing that may be slippery on the floor. We recommend using rug underlay for grip and floor protection.
Brush the shaggy rug:
- Rugs with long pile need to be brushed regularly to maintain fibre appearance. Use a wide-toothed comb.
Shedding:
- Wool rugs shed, especially those with pile. This is normal and a characteristic of the fibre. Shedding may be most intense when the rug is new. However, there is no guarantee that shedding will reduce over time. Vacuum the rug regularly with a brush head to remove excess fibres from production. We also recommend shaking the rug before use to fluff up the pile and remove excess wool.
Rotate the rug:
- Rotate the rug in the room regularly to ensure even exposure and wear.
Stains:
- Always address minor stains promptly. Blot wet stains with dry paper towels.
- For dry stains, gently scrape from the stain's edges towards the centre. Dampen an uncoloured cloth or sponge with lukewarm water and mild soap. Work the soap into a lather with lukewarm water before applying. Do not rub the stain as it may become harder to remove. Blot the area to absorb the liquid and repeat until the stain is gone.
- Avoid using strong chemicals for home stain treatments. Tough stains should be handled by professionals, preferably soon after the stain occurs to improve fibre cleaning chances.
Rug cleaning by professionals:
- Always take your rug to a reputable cleaner for professional flat washing. Classic Collection rugs should not be machine or dry cleaned.
Additional information:
- All new rugs have a distinct odour that dissipates over time. Ventilating or vacuuming the rug will help the odour disappear.
